@charset "utf-8";
/* CSS Document */
body, div, span, object, iframe, h1, h2, h3, h4, h5, h6, p, blockquote, a, code, em, img, q, small, strong, dd, dl, dt, li, ol, ul, fieldset, form, label, table, tbody, tr, th, td ,input {
    margin: 0;
    padding: 0;
}
div{_display:inline;}
body {
    font-size:12px;
    font-family:Tahoma,Verdana,sans-serif, simsun;
	color:#666;
	width:790px;
	margin:0 auto;
	background:#eee url(../images/bg.png) repeat-x;
	position:relative;
}

a img, :link img, :visited img {border: 0;}
a{
	color:#666;
	text-decoration:none;
	}
a:hover{
	color:#ccc;
	text-decoration:underline;
	}
table {border-collapse:collapse;}

ul {list-style:none;}

q:before, q:after,blockquote:before, blockquote:after {content: "";}
.relative{position:relative;}
/*----------------------------fontcolor---------------------------------------*/
.cfff{
	color:#fff;
	}
.cff0{
	color:#ff0;
	}
.cced8e2{
	color:#ced8e2;
	}
/*清理------------------------------------------------------------------------------------------------------*/
.clearfix:after {
  content: ".";
  clear: both;
  height: 0;
  visibility: hidden;
  display: block;
}            /* 这是对Firefox进行的处理，因为Firefox支持生成元素，而IE所有版本都不支持生成元素 */
.clearfix {
  display: inline-block;    
}                /* 这是对 Mac 上的IE浏览器进行的处理 */
/**//* Hides from IE-mac \*/
* html .clearfix {height: 1%;}        /* 这是对 win 上的IE浏览器进行的处理 */
.clearfix {display: block;}        /* 这是对display: inline-block;进行的修改，重置为区块元素*/
/**//* End hide from IE-mac */    
/*清理结束------------------------------------------------------------------------------------------------------*/
.passlogo{
	float:left;
	margin-top:28px;
	margin-bottom:15px;
	background:url(../images/bg_pass.jpg) center bottom no-repeat;
	padding-bottom:25px;
	width:100%;
	}
.botton{
	background: url(../images/botton.gif) left top no-repeat;
	height:22px;
	float:left;
	margin-right:6px;
	}
.botton .bcorner{
	background:url(../images/botton_corner.gif) right top no-repeat;
	height:22px;
	line-height:22px;
	padding:0 10px 0 10px;
	color:#333;
	display:inline-block;
	}
.bottonB{
	background: url(../images/bottonB.gif) left top no-repeat;
	height:22px;
	float:left;
	margin-right:6px;
	}
.bottonB .bcorner{
	background:url(../images/bottonB_corner.gif) right top no-repeat;
	height:22px;
	line-height:22px;
	padding:0 10px 0 10px;
	color:#fff;
	font-weight:bold;
	display:inline-block;
	}
.more{
	background: url(../images/bg_more.gif) left top no-repeat;
	height:17px;
	float:right;
	margin-right:10px;
	_padding-top:-1px;
	}
.more .mcorner{
	background:url(../images/bg_morecorner.gif) right top no-repeat;
	height:17px;
	line-height:15px;
	padding:0 10px 0 10px;
	color:#333;
	display:inline-block;
	_display:inline;
	}
.iconround{
	background:url(../images/icon_round.gif) left 50% no-repeat;
	padding-left:20px;
	}
.iconnews{
	background:url(../images/icon_news.gif) left 50% no-repeat;
	padding-left:20px;
	}
.iconhuodong{
	background:url(../images/icon_huodong.gif) left 50% no-repeat;
	padding-left:20px;
	}
.iconfunction{
	background:url(../images/icon_function.gif) left 50% no-repeat;
	padding-left:25px;
	}
.iconquestion{
	background:url(../images/icon_question.gif) left 50% no-repeat;
	padding-left:20px;
	}
/*------------------------------------------------------底部-----------------------------*/
.pagefoot{
	margin:28px 0 18px 0;
	clear:both;
	}
/*------------------------------------------------------底部结束-------------------------*/
/*------------------------------------------------------主体大框架-----------------------*/
h3{
	font-size:12px;
	color:#333;
	}
h4{
	font-size:12px;
	font-weight:normal;
	color:#333;
	}
h4 strong{
	color:#b6b6b6;
	font-size:10px;
	}
.panel{
	background:#eee url(../images/panelLT.gif) left top no-repeat;
	float:left;
	margin-bottom:9px;
	}
.panel .pcontent{
	background: url(../images/panelRT.gif) right top no-repeat;
	padding-top:9px;
	float:left;
	}
.panel .pcontent .pbottom{
	background: url(../images/panelLB.gif) left bottom no-repeat;
	float:left;
	}
.panel .pcontent .pbottom .corner{
	background: url(../images/panelRB.gif) right bottom no-repeat;
	float:left;
	padding:0 3px 10px 3px;
	}
.panel .bgcontent{
	background:url(../images/bg_contentL.gif) left top no-repeat;
	float:left;
	}
.panel .bgcontent .ccorner{
	background:url(../images/bg_contentR.gif) right top no-repeat;
	float:left;
	padding:9px 8px 0px 8px;
	}
.panel h3,.panel h4{
	margin:0 0 4px 5px;
	height:20px;
	line-height:20px;
	}
.aB-a{
	width:268px;
	margin-right:9px;
	_margin-right:9px;
	float:left;
	}
.aB-B{
	width:513px;
	float:left;
	}
.aB-a2{
	width:201px;
	margin-right:9px;
	_margin-right:4px;
	float:left;
	}
.aB-B2{
	width:580px;
	float:left;
	}
.mainbar{
	background:url(../images/mainbanner.jpg) top no-repeat;
	height:283px;
	width:843px;
	margin-left:24px;
	display:block;
	float:left;
	display:inline;
	}
.line{
	background:url(../images/line.gif) repeat-x;
	width:100%;
	float:left;
	height:2px;
	font-size:0;
	margin-top:6px;
	}
/*------------------------------------------------------主体大框架结束-------------------*/	

